比特币在区块链中的记录机制与发展历程

时间:2026-01-17 13:03:09

主页 > 问题 >

          比特币作为首个去中心化的数字货币,依赖于区块链技术来保障其交易的安全与透明。区块链不仅是比特币的基础,也是理解其运作原理的关键。在这篇文章中,我们将深入探讨比特币在区块链中的记录方式,以下内容将涵盖比特币的历史、运作机制、技术细节,以及相关的未来发展趋势。

          一、比特币的起源与发展

          比特币由中本聪于2009年首次提出,并在同年推出了第一个比特币客户端。其核心思想是创建一个无需第三方中介的点对点电子现金系统。比特币的白皮书详细描述了区块链如何解决双重支付问题,使得交易可以安全且不可篡改地记录在分布式账本上。

          随着时间的推移,比特币的应用和接受度逐渐增加。它不仅成为了一种投资资产,还被广泛接受为商品和服务的支付手段。比特币的总量限制在2100万枚,使得其在全球经济中的稀缺性逐渐凸显。

          二、区块链的基本概念

          区块链是一个去中心化的数据库,数据以块(Block)的形式被记录,每个块通过密码学方式连接。比特币区块链的每个块包含若干交易信息以及前一个块的哈希值,因此形成了一个不可篡改的链条。

          与传统数据库不同,区块链的每一份副本都存储在全球数以千计的节点(Node)上,这意味着任何人都可以参与到网络中,并传播自己计算出的区块信息。通过“工作量证明”(Proof of Work)机制,矿工们需要解决复杂的数学问题才能创建新的块并获得比特币作为奖励。这一过程保证了区块的合法性和网络的安全性。

          三、比特币的交易记录机制

          每一笔比特币交易都需要在区块链上进行确认。用户通过比特币钱包发起交易,将其发送给接收者,同时在网络中进行广播。随后,矿工们将交易信息打包入新的区块中,经过解算后添加到区块链的末尾。

          交易记录的验证过程包括确认交易发起者的权限,以及双重支付的检查。这意味着如果一个用户同时试图在两个或多个交易中使用同一枚比特币,区块链会拒绝其中一个交易,确保每一笔比特币的安全和唯一性。

          四、区块链中的安全性机制

          比特币区块链采取多种安全机制以防止恶意攻击。首先,使用密码学方法保护每个块的信息,确保数据的机密性和完整性。其次,工作量证明机制通过让矿工竞争来增加新块的难度,增加了网络被攻击的成本。此外,区块链的去中心化特性使得攻击者无法控制网络中的大多数节点,进一步增强了其安全性。

          为了防止51%攻击(即当某个实体控制了超过50%的算力时,可以重写交易记录),比特币网络不断吸引更多的参与者,增加整体算力的分散度,从而提高安全性。

          五、比特币的未来与挑战

          尽管比特币在区块链技术的推动下取得了巨大的成功,但其未来仍面临诸多挑战。例如,交易的确认时间和手续费的波动,可能会影响用户的体验。在网络扩展中,区块容量的限制也导致了交易的拥堵。

          为了解决这些问题,开发者们正在积极探索各种改进方案,包括闪电网络(Lightning Network),该技术旨在提高交易速度并降低费用。此外,法律法规也日益引起监管机构的关注,对比特币及其他数字货币的监管政策将对其未来的发展起到至关重要的作用。

          相关问题及详细解答

          1. 比特币如何在区块链中进行交易?

          比特币的交易过程首先需要用户在钱包中创建一笔交易,将比特币发送给接收者。用户需要输入接收方的比特币地址,并指定发送的比特币数量。交易发起后,它会通过网络广播到比特币网络中。接下来,矿工们会将这笔交易打包入新的区块中,进行验证。通过工作量证明机制,该区块将被添加到区块链上,并完成交易的确认。

          2. 区块链的去中心化如何保护比特币的安全?

          区块链的去中心化特性意味着没有单一实体控制整个网络。所有用户都可以参与到网络中,各自存储完整的区块链副本。在这种情况下,修改或篡改交易记录需要控制网络绝大多数节点,这在技术和成本上几乎是不可能的。因此,去中心化带来了更强的抵御攻击的能力。此外,整个网络的透明性使得任何恶意行为都能被迅速发现。

          3. 比特币的交易费用是如何产生的?

          比特币的交易费用是矿工用来激励他们记录交易的奖励之一。每当用户发起交易时,可以自愿设置交易的费用,费用越高,矿工优先处理该交易的概率越大。交易费用主要用于网络拥堵时的优先级选择,用户希望获取更快的确认时,支付更高的费用来提高交易被确认的速度。

          4. 比特币的挖矿过程是怎样的?

          比特币的挖矿过程涉及使用计算机解决复杂的数学问题。矿工们通过计算工作量证明,寻找一个符合难度目标的哈希值。在成功挖掘出一个新区块后,矿工将该区块添加到区块链,并获得比特币的奖励,以及区块中所有交易的费用。挖矿不仅确保了交易的安全性与诚信,还通过减少发行量来维护比特币的稀缺性。

          5. 未来的区块链技术会如何影响比特币?

          未来的区块链技术可能会带来革命性的变化,影响比特币的功能与应用。例如,随着二层解决方案的出现,如闪电网络,交易的速度和成本将得到显著改进。而企业对区块链技术的接受度正在上升,可能会使比特币作为资产的角色更加稳定。同时,关于隐私保护、扩展性和互操作性的技术研究也可能推动新的协议和标准的出现,确保比特币保持竞争力。

          总结来看,比特币的区块链记录机制不仅在技术上具有创新意义,也在金融世界中引发了深远的变革。随着技术的发展和市场的不断变化,比特币及其背后的区块链将继续演进,前景广阔。